    PMD Pro is a Project Management certification scheme designed for NGOs which: The scheme was developed by APMG-International in partnership with Project Management for NGOs (PM4NGOs), an organization dedicated to optimizing international project investments and improving professional project management skills in the development sector. This certification is seen as an important benchmark for continuous improvement. The scheme is aligned with existing internationally recognized project management standards and includes components specific to the NGO sector. Project Management in Development (PMD Pro) is a specialised certification scheme for Project Managers working in the development sector.
